Rainer wrote:
> is it possible to increase the MTU on any Ethernet interface available
> for 7200 routers? Searching cisco.com or googling around didn't turn up
> anything helpful.
> 
> So far I had no luck with io-2fe, io-1fe-tx-isl and pa-1fa-tx-isl.

Hoping others may find this when googling here are my results:

I had no chance to increase the "real" MTU of any of the above
interfaces. 

With 12.2.15T I was able to increase the "tag-switch mtu" for io-2fe und
pa-1fe-tx up to 1534. I've done this only on the main interface.
Although this workaround is documented somewhere on the cisco site, I
could not find any hint about the maximum size.

Configuring dot1q on a subinterface increased the mtu in 
"show controllers FastEthernet", but had no effect on the packet size I 
could get through the MPLS main interface.
